NDCC: Death toll in Mindanao fighting now at 66
In its report posted on its website, the NDCC also said at least 78 were reported injured while two civilians remain missing to date.
NDCC said that of the 66 fatalities, 43 were from Region 10, 15 from the Autonomous Region in Muslim Mindanao (ARMM), and eight in Region 12.
Of the 66 people killed, 57 were civilians, seven were law enforcers, and two were members of the MILF.
As for the 78 injured, the NDCC said 65 are civilians and 13 are law enforcement operatives.
The NDCC also identified the two missing civilians as Ruben Lopez and Alexis Kidlat, both of Kolambugan town in Lanao del Norte.
Lanao del Norte was one of the provinces attacked by the MILF last Aug. 18.
The NDCC also said the fighting had affected 88,243 families or 423,772 persons. Of these, 87,378 families or 419,447 persons still need assistance. - GMANews.TV
